We were just thinking last night that it’s been a while since we’ve seen a BMX video from Zak Earley and then poof… A brand new Windowless Van video pops up giving us a look at some dialed trails, skatepark and street footage of Zak, Adam Aloise, Joe Hulette and Anthony Maimone from a recent trip Zac took in the van. As always Zak comes through with some excellent riding, and the film work is real clean. Take a peek!
“Change is inevitable. Without change, there is no progress and without progress; no success. Shooting from the Hip was a concept produced over way too many cups of coffee and a few days time. There was no set plan, only constantly evolving skeletal framework and a few set locations. The timing, the execution and the outcome were all a direct product of the saying. React quickly, consider less and the rest will come naturally.”

Mongoose coming in hot with a fresh BMX video from Ben Wallace who took a break from sunny California, where he calls home these days, to that less sunny place known as Scotland to ride Unit 23 Skatepark! Ben chimes in on a few different topics like his first bike, injuries and more while he absolutely crushes the skatepark. So much style in this one and that ender… DAMN! Enjoy!
